About the role

  • Learning & Development Partner managing learning systems and optimizing compliance programs at Five9. Designing impactful global learning experiences in a dynamic and experienced team.

Responsibilities

  • Design, develop, and curate onboarding and ongoing learning content, including e-learning (Articulate 360), microlearning, presentations, and resources aligned to business needs.
  • Coordinate and deliver new-hire onboarding and orientation sessions, including logistics, scheduling, global calendars, and content updates.
  • Support learning programs end-to-end, including project coordination, communications, surveys, and continuous improvement based on learner feedback and effectiveness metrics.
  • Support administration of the Learning Hub (LMS/LXP), including system configuration, content management, data integrity, integrations, and vendor coordination.
  • Administer and track mandatory compliance training, ensuring timely completion, accurate records, audit readiness, and alignment with Legal, Compliance, and HR requirements.
  • Assist in maintaining dashboards and reports to measure learning participation, effectiveness, and compliance, translating data into actionable insights.
  • Guide users in accessing plans and role-based pathways, providing guidance on navigating learning platforms and curated content and increasing adoption.
  • Support learners and escalate complex issues for employee inquiries, managing support tickets, troubleshooting issues, and partnering with HR, IT, and vendors for resolution.
  • Develop and maintain self-service resources (FAQs, job aids, knowledge articles) to improve learner experience and reduce support volume.
